Ejector Pump Installation in Framingham, MA
Ejector pump installation services are essential for homeowners dealing with basement or lower-level plumbing that requires efficient removal of wastewater and sewage. These systems are designed to pump waste from areas that are below the main sewer line or where gravity drainage is not possible, such as in homes with finished basements or additions. Projects typically involve installing ejector pumps in new constructions, remodeling jobs, or replacing outdated or malfunctioning units to ensure reliable sewage removal and prevent backups or flooding.
Property owners considering ejector pump installation should understand the importance of proper system sizing, compatibility with existing plumbing, and the location of the pump within the property. It’s also helpful to know whether the installation will require any additional drainage or electrical work. Clarifying these details can help ensure the system functions effectively and meets the specific needs of the property, providing peace of mind for long-term operation.

Ejector Pump Installation Questions
What is an ejector pump used for? An ejector pump is used to remove wastewater from basement bathrooms, laundry rooms, or other areas below the main sewer line.
How do I know if an ejector pump is needed? It is typically needed when plumbing fixtures are located below the main sewer line or in basement areas where gravity drainage isn't possible.
What are common projects for ejector pump installation? Installing ejector pumps is common in basement bathroom additions, laundry rooms, or converting crawl spaces into usable areas.
What should property owners consider before installation? Ensuring proper placement, adequate power supply, and access for maintenance are important for effective ejector pump operation.
